Abstract

Technology which is coming under the Ubiquitous Computing. Cloud services are delivered from the data centers located throughout the world. Cloud services and Cloud issues and challenges are described in this paper. Cloud Computing is a novice technology and it is very familiar among IT users for providing its large variety resources among its consumers. The authors, discussed various load balancing and scheduling techniques to improve QoS (Quality of Service] in cloud. This paper would benefit researchers to explore the research areas in cloud computing.
